A large, well-known charity is seeking a Senior Finance Business Partner to join its finance team on a 12-month fixed-term contract. Based in Central London with a hybrid working pattern of two days per week in the office, this is an excellent opportunity to support one of the organisation's key fundraising directorates while leading a small team of Finance Business Partners.

Please note: The successful candidate must be available to commence the role in October.

The key responsibilities of the Senior Finance Business Partner are:

  • Acting as the lead finance partner to a major fundraising directorate, providing insightful financial support to senior stakeholders.
  • Building strong relationships with Directors and senior budget holders, supporting decision-making through robust financial analysis and commercial insight.
  • Leading the budgeting, forecasting and month-end reporting processes for your business area, ensuring timely and accurate financial information.
  • Reviewing management accounts, journals and financial reporting prepared by the wider team, ensuring the highest standards of accuracy.
  • Supporting the development of business cases, income projections and financial modelling to inform strategic initiatives.
  • Leading, mentoring and developing two direct reports, helping to strengthen business partnering capability within the team.
  • Identifying opportunities to improve financial processes, reporting and the use of financial data to support operational performance.
  • Supporting finance transformation initiatives and contributing to future systems and reporting improvements where required.

The successful candidate will have:

  • A recognised professional accounting qualification (ACA, ACCA, CIMA or equivalent).
  • Previous charity sector experience, which is essential.
  • Demonstrable experience operating in a Finance Business Partner or Senior Finance Business Partner role.
  • Strong people management experience, with the ability to coach and develop finance professionals.
  • Excellent business partnering and stakeholder management skills, with the confidence to influence senior leaders.
  • Experience supporting fundraising, income generation or other commercially focused functions would be highly advantageous.
  • Strong analytical skills, with experience producing financial models, forecasts and business cases.
  • A proactive and collaborative approach, with the 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ment.
